Selecting Between Stick and Plug-in Vacuum Cleaners

The age-old debate: stick versus plug-in vacuum cleaners! Both offer effective tidying solutions, but cater to different needs and preferences. Cordless vacuums offer unmatched freedom, allowing you to move effortlessly around your residence without the frustration of tangled cords. They’re especially ideal for spot cleanups and for those with multiple stories. However, runtime remains a key consideration, as you're reliant on electricity and may experience decreased suction as it depletes. In contrast, plug-in models provide consistent, steady power and often boast greater suction for tackling deeper dirt and debris. While the need for an outlet can limit maneuverability, they are typically favored for thorough cleaning of larger areas and for users who prioritize power over convenience. Ultimately, the “best” choice depends entirely on your specific routine and cleaning priorities.

Looking after Your Vacuum Cleaner

Regularly cleaning your vacuum device is crucial for consistent performance and extending more info its lifespan. Start by emptying the dust bin after each use – this prevents clogs and maintains suction power. Next, check the filters; many models have both a pre-filter and a HEPA filter. These should be rinsed according to the manufacturer’s instructions, often every some months. Don't forget to unplug any blockages from the hose and attachments – tangled hair and debris are common culprits. Finally, wipe the exterior of the vacuum with a damp cloth to keep it looking its best and remove accumulated dust and grime. A little preventative maintenance now can save you from costly fixes later!
